luke.kendall@cisra.canon.com.au wrote:
> If at a fresh bash prompt in an rxvt window (non-X) you type a TAB,
> nothing happens, and no input from the keyboard appears thereafter,
> until you use CTRL-C to interrupt whatever has blocked.
Putting
shopt -s no_empty_cmd_completion
in your .bash_profile is a good way to avoid this.
